The postcode SO19 6NX is located in Southampton It was introduced in December 1994 and is an active postcode. SO19 6NX is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SO19 6NX is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SO19 6NX as Constrained city dwellers > White communities > Challenged transitionaries.

The closest road name to SO19 6NX is Tunstall Road which is centered 60 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Meredith Towers and is 25 m away. The closest railway station is Sholing Rail Station, 2.6 km away.

The closest primary school to SO19 6NX (for ages 11 and under) is Hightown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on May 10, 2018.

The local pub for residents of SO19 6NX is The Hinkler and is 333 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on January 16, 2018. The nearest takeaway food is available from Golden Leaf and is 204 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on January 14, 2015.

Residents reported an average download speed of 79.9 Mbps and an average upload speed of 12.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Policing for SO19 6NX is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Southampton City is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
